Mazda calls it 4921G. NHTSA filed it as campaign 21V494000 on Jul 1, 2021: air bags on the 2004–2007 Mazda MAZDA3, 260,915 vehicles potentially affected. One recall, two numbers — the dealer quotes the manufacturer’s, the federal record carries NHTSA’s.

Problem Mazda North American Operations (Mazda) is recalling certain 2004-2007 Mazda3 vehicles. During air bag deployment, the plastic emblem on the steering wheel air bag module cover may shatter, and project plastic fragments into the vehicle. Risk Plastic fragments can hit occupants during air bag deployment, increasing the risk of injury. Fix Dealers will replace the air bag module cover, free of charge. Owner letters were mailed between August 28, 2021 and October 28, 2021. Owners may contact Mazda customer service at 1-800-222-5500 Option 4. Mazda's number for this recall is 4921G.

Two numbers, one recall

Every safety recall carries two identifiers. 4921G is the number Mazda assigned in its own system: it is what appears on the owner letter, on the dealer’s service screen and on the repair order. 21V494000 is the number NHTSA filed the same recall under when the manufacturer reported it, and it is the one every federal record, this site included, is keyed on.

The repair is free by federal law for vehicles up to fifteen years old. Whether one particular vehicle is included is settled by its VIN against the manufacturer’s build list, not by its model year.

Is 4921G the same recall as 21V494000?

Yes. 4921G is Mazda’s own number for it; 21V494000 is NHTSA’s. One recall, two references.

Which vehicles does 4921G cover?

2004–2007 Mazda MAZDA3, 260,915 vehicles by the manufacturer’s count. A recall covers a build range, so the VIN decides whether one particular vehicle is in it.

Does the 4921G repair cost anything?

No. The manufacturer must remedy a safety defect at no charge for vehicles up to 15 years old from first sale.
